Types of Wiring Systems
Before we get into the nitty gritty of wiring a home AC compressor, it’s important to know what types of wiring systems are available. The two primary types are split-system wiring and package unit wiring. With a split-system wiring arrangement, the compressor and condensing unit are separate from the evaporator unit, which is usually found on the interior of the home. Package unit wiring, on the other hand, combines both the compressor and condenser in one unit, located outside the home.
